Men's Track & Field Scores Staggering Team Total to Dominate the Carroll University Open

WAUKESHA, Wis. – The MSOE men's track & field set a school recording team score to dominate the outdoor opener at the Carroll University Open.

RESULTS
1st Place – 331.5 pts 

RECAP 
  • The Raiders kicked off the day sweeping the 10,000-meter run as Zach Zuzzio won in 32:38.97 and Lucas Skupien in second in 33:14.86. The group of Jack Schwartz, Nana Adubofour, Nathaniel Asiedu-Mensah, and Camden Nennig won the 4x100-meter relay, clocking a time of 43.26. The Raiders continued their run of sweeping events, going 1-4 in the 3,000-meter steeplechase with Sam McPeak leading the charge in 9:30.53. Jack Dorner won the 1,500-meter run with a time 4:09.99, with Owen Recoy taking second in 4:17.76.
  • Sam Sorenson cleared the field in the 110-meter hurdles, finishing over a second than the rest of the field in 15.04. AJ Springer also ran away from the field off of his Indoor National Championship run in the 800-meter run, finishing in 1:54.71. Schwartz won the 400-meter hurdles in 58.80, while Joseph Hillyer led a 1-2 finish in the 5,000-meter run as he went 15:39.81 and Ryan Alyassir finished second in 15:44.82. Schwartz, Springer, Chase Nogalski, and Daniel Geerts capped off the running events winning the 4x400-meter relay in 3:32.57.
  • Over in the field events, Bob Sibigtroth cleared 1.80 meters in the high jump to capture the event. The Raiders completely dominated the pole vault, taking the top seven spots led by Korvan Nameni and Cameron O'Brien going 4.40 meters and Zach Lehrer going 4.10 meters. Joel Walter won the triple jump with 12.89 meters, followed by Adubofour in second with 12.87 meters and James Paulson in third with 12.69 meters. Over in the throws, Ethan Wrasman finished as the top collegian in the hammer throw, launching it 49.55 meters to finish in third. Wrasman also had a third-place finish in the shot put with 14.45 meters, finishing behind Elijah Villa who took second with 14.72 meters.
